13 Children Injured by Electrocution During Ugadi Chariot Procession in Andhra Pradesh

Visakhapatnam: At least 13 children were injured when the chariot of a Ugadi procession touched an overhead high-voltage electric wire at Tekur village in Andhra Pradesh’s Kurnool district.

The electrocuted children were admitted to a hospital in Kurnool for treatment. The doctors confirmed that the children were out of danger. All injuries were reported to be below 10 per cent severity, with no fatalities recorded.

YSRCP leader and Panyam MLA Katasani Ramabhupal Reddy and Nandyala TDP candidate Byreddy Shabari visited the hospital to meet the injured children.
